I haven't watched the video yet, but the boots look fantastic! Good job. Two things.

-Did you read in the instructions about how you should wrap the velcro strap on the gaiter back over itself if necessary to get the gaiter nice and tight about her pastern?

-I see that you have the cable on the farthest tooth out. Is the clamp snapping down nice and tight like a ski boot? You'll see in the instructions that you can weave the cable around the top a little bit to take slack out of the cable to get a tighter adjustment on the clamp if necessary.
